Aru'mon was once the commanding officer of the Darkspear Axe Throwers during the Horde's campaign against the Lich King. The events that transpired at Angrathar the Wrathgate would prove catastrophic to his own life. After Putress' betrayal, many survivors panicked and ran away into the arctic wilderness in Northrend. So was the case of Aru'mon. Losing the grip of his own thoughts and actions, he hid within a Magnataur cave. He miraculously evaded capture and managed to endure the hardships of the land. But of course, everything has it's final end, including Aru'Mon. He was discovered by undead drakkari and brought in front of the Lich King. Just the same way the Immolated Champion resisted the Lich King's influence. Seeing potential in his new progeny, he used his powers to transform Aru'mon into a vile creature of undeath. He became a private agent working directly for the Lich King himself. His service, however, was short-lived due to Arthas' defeat at the hands of the Ashen Verdict. His death released many undead minions from his iron grip. Bolvar Fordragon's rise as the new Lich King signaled the end of Scourge hostilities. These minions of the Scourge were then left "unemployed" and some joined the Forsaken while a handful rested well within Icecrown's boundaries. Seeing no other reason to stay alive, Aru'mon remained fiercely loyal to his new master. The Lich King later sent three ambassadors of the Scourge to the capital cities of the Horde and Alliance. In addition to these ambassadors, Aru'mon was secretly deployed to these lands to continue spying on the living. Along his journey across Azeroth, he encountered the future threat to their world. The Twilight's Hammer cult. The Lich King showed empathy towards the living races and resolved into joining forces with the Forsaken to end the threat of the cultists. Aru'mon was considered a trigger to these events...
